哈喽,你们听过Laravel和CodeIgniter这两个名字吗?他们是现在最火的PHP开发框架,一直在升级,争取做到让每个人都满意。那咱今儿就来说说这俩家伙现在和未来咋样呗,帮你选个最适合你项目的!
Laravel的近期更新
告诉你们个事儿,Laravel已经升级到了9版这次更新多了不少云服务的功能,查询速度快得很,用着超爽!听说以后可能还会出个新的Laravel版本,叫做Laravel10,据说这个版本会让框架更稳,还会带好多实用的工具!
哇,有了Laravel9的新功能,你的APP可以直接跑在亚马逊网络服务(AWS)、谷歌云计算(GoogleCloud)或微软智能云Azure上!这个功能真的很方便,不再需要那么繁琐地部署APP,解决了很多难题。而且,它还能提高数据库性能,处理大量数据也没问题了!
CodeIgniter的近期更新
告诉你个劲爆的消息,CodeIgniter已经升级到4.2版本!这个新版加入了防范网络攻击的防护功能,而且听说还要推出一个叫CodeIgniter5的超大型更新。据说这次的重点在于加快速度和提高稳定性,让你的网站飞起来!
说实话,CI4.2,你知道吗?就是让我们的网站更安全了。这个玩意儿修复了好多漏洞,提高了防御力度,咱们以后弄什么软件或者上线,啥也不怕了,安心得很!尤其好用的是那些功能,比如输入验证、输出编码、SQL注入和XSS攻击防护等等,全都不在话下。
Laravel的未来发展方向
就直接说说,Laravel在几个地方做了不少改进呢:首先,他们把云平台的整合做得更好了,让我们用起云资源来更方便;然后,他们还把测试和调试工具升级了,这样我们编码速度快,质量也好没问题;还有就是,他们现在也开始关注人工智能和机器学习了。他们跟很多云服务公司都有合作,让我们用得更舒心;而且,他们还会继续提高测试和调试工具,让我们的工作效率飞速上升!
告诉你个好消息,Laravel最近有点大动作,要把人工智能跟机器学习也纳入其中!这样的话,咱们这帮编程小能手不就是多了一堆好用的新工具!想想看,以后我们开发的软件还能进行智能化的推荐和异常检测,那事儿可真是方便不少!所以说,咱们做出来的软件现在可是越来越聪明
CodeIgniter的未来发展方向
别纠结那么复杂的框架,来看看CodeIgniter的新鲜事儿!这个真的是轻松搞定,不用担心换平台之类的问题。老项目升级到最新的版本,马上就能跑起来,新功能也能随时上手。而且CodeIgniter还在不断改进核心功能,运行速度更快,性能更好,不管什么环境,你的app都能飞快地运行。
这个小东西真是做网站的得力助手,尤其是你出门在外,没有电脑的时候。虽然看上去有点复杂,但用起来超简单,摸索摸索就能熟练掌握!这就是它最大的魅力所在!
Laravel和CodeIgniter的差异比较
想让项目顺利进行吗?选Laravel!虽然比不上CodeIgniter全能,但应付大部分问题还是没问题滴。想快点搞掂?那就用CodeIgniter!它速度飞快,使用起来简单得不得了~
Route::resource('products', 'ProductController'); $products = Product::all();
Laravel确实很厉害,能干大活儿!要学会可不容易呐,得全神贯注才行!不过话说回来,CodeIgniter入门容易些,做些小项目还行。但是碰到复杂点儿的问题,那可就麻烦了。
Laravel示例
别墨迹了,赶紧试试Laravel,真是太好用!搞定用户管理就跟吃饭喝水一样轻松。注册、登录、权限这些头疼事全都交给Laravel,瞬间解决烦恼。还有,这个神器框架里面有好多厉害的小工具,EloquentORM、路由系统和中间件等等,让你编程速度飞起!
$router->add('products', 'Products::index'); $products = $this->db->get('products')->result();
别怕用Laravel搞定数据库和信息管理,超简单的!路由配对?那更是小菜一碟,只需要在网址和控制器之间搭个桥,就搞定。想要做好事情,首先要有好工具,Laravel就是这样的神器,让你处理大型项目也能游刃有余!
CodeIgniter示例
用CI搭建博客,发布文章、编辑内容还有搞定那些乱七八糟的东西,真心简单得不得了,挺爽的,真是省时省力。
试试看CodeIgniter的博客,想怎么装扮就怎么装扮!路由功能棒极了,还能处理数据库,做起来省事多了~怪不得小项目们都爱用它哈。
总结
这俩软件版本一升级,各有所长。Laravel主要做大项目,就是处理大数据、测试什么的,功能高大上;CodeIgniter就简单多了,但优点就是速度飞快,小项目轻轻松松就能完成。那选哪个好?其实得看看你的项目需要啥和你们团队喜欢哪款!
你们说说,哪款框架最顺手?功能多点好还是简单快手更赞?快来评论区聊聊~别忘了给这篇文章点赞转发让大伙儿都看看Laravel跟CodeIgniter的差别在哪!
评论0